Less than 1:64: Negative - No significant level of IgG antibody detected. 1:64 - 1:128: Low Positive - Presence of IgG antibody detected, suggestive of current or past infection. 1:256 or greater: Positive - Presence of IgG antibody suggestive of recent or current infection. Summary – CMV IgG vs IgM. What is CMV IgG? CMV IgG is one of the two types of CMV antibodies. CMV IgG appears after 1 to 2 weeks of IgM antibody detection. It shows a peak at 2 to 3 months post-infection. Then it remains detectable throughout the lifetime.
WebAmong 13 suspected Rocky Mountain spotted fever (RMSF) cases identified through an enhanced surveillance program in Tennessee, antibodies to Rickettsia rickettsii were detected in 10 (77%) patients using a standard indirect immunofluorescent antibody (IFA) assay. Immunoglobulin M (IgM) antibodies were observed for 6 of 13 patients (46%) …
